Collagen is the most abundant protein in the body. Its fiber-like structure is used to make connective tissue. Like the name implies, this type of tissue connects other tissues and is a major component of bone, skin, …

Thermage is one of the leading heat-based treatments that utilises radiofrequency heat energy to stimulate and remodel natural collagen stores. Collagen is a natural skin protein that is fundamentally important to keeping our skin looking smooth, contoured and firm.
